The Queen’s 1947 wedding brought back to life in £100m Netflix drama

As 9th September draws ever closer, when Her Majesty will overtake Queen Victoria as the country’s longest-reigning monarch, there’s no end to the amount of retrospective coverage; looking back over her 63-year reign and its highs and lows.
Now, US-based streaming service Netflix are set to take advantage of the royal fanfare in a £100m drama, The Crown – tracing The Queen’s reign from her wedding to The Duke of Edinburgh in 1947 through to the present day.
The 60-episode series, which is expected to air next year, will star Claire Foy as the 21-year old Princess Elizabeth and former Doctor Who star Matt Smith will play the young Duke of Edinburgh. Foy has already experienced royal portrayal earlier this year, starring as a young Anne Boleyn in the BBC’s historical drama, Wolf Hall.
Groups of extras, dressed in authentic 1940s attire, lined the streets outside Ely Cathedral on Wednesday as filming began of the original royal wedding. The cathedral, built over 700 years ago, is acting as an ‘alternative Westminster Abbey’ backdrop for the spectacular royal event and the set was a true mashup of modern and vintage as modern green screens and vintage 1940’s cameras mixed.

A teenage girl who has been verbally abused for years by other children has revealed how she has come to love the hundreds of birthmarks covering her face and body.
Ciera Swaringen, 19, of Rockwell, North Carolina, was diagnosed with Giant Congenital Melanocytic Nevus after being born with the oversized mole-like marks.
They cover more than two-thirds of her body, with the largest one stretching from her navel to her lower thighs. 
Since she was a small child, she has had to endure cruel taunts from other children - and adults - but she has developed a positive attitude towards her rare skin condition, which affects around one in every 500,000 people.

Chinese among 22 killed in deadly Bangkok explosion

CCTVNews's photo.Chinese among 22 killed in deadly Bangkok explosion
At least 22 people were killed and 117 others injured as of Tuesday morning in the deadly explosion that hit downtown Bangkok on Monday night.
Two Chinese mainlanders and two Hong Kong resident were among the dead, while at least 11 Chinese were injured according to China’s embassy.
Up to ten Thais and one Filipino were also killed, while others are yet to be confirmed.
The Chinese Foreign Ministry has initiated an emergency response, demanding its embassy in Thailand start immediate investigations and put in all efforts to help the injured.

Barely three months after he handed-over power to President Muhammadu Buhari, ex-President Goodluck Jonathan has continued to keep mum on public matters.
Jonathan
Former President Goodluck Jonathan and his wife, Dame Patience pictured landing in Kenya for a weekend holiday
Jonathan who, Weekend, visited Kenya’s Maasai Mara Games Reserve on a chartered plane with his wife, Patience and two children was reported by the Kenyan media to have refused to speak to journalists on arriving the Games Reserve.
He is at the reserve for a three-day tour to witness the wildebeest migration. Jonathan was booked at the new Angama Mara Lodge at the Oloololo conservancy.
The ex-president was received by Narok Governor Samuel Tunai. Tunai, who is also the Council of  Governors tourism committee chairman, said more than 500,000 tourists from all over the world are expected to witness the spectacular crossing of wildebeest across the crocodile-infested Mara River.
According to Kenya media, Jonathan is the second dignitary to visit the reserve in less than a fortnight after the King of Swasiland, Mswati III. The king was booked in the same lodge six days ago.
The owner of the hotel, Nicky Fitzgerald, said this tourism peak season is different from the past as prominent personalities from across the world have been calling for bookings.
“We have received Mr Jonathan, King Mswati III, a Chinese prominent family and we are expecting other royalties,” said Ms Fitzgerald.
Ms Fitzgerald said United States (U.S.) President Barrack Obama’s visit last month was a boost for tourism in Kenya.
The trooping in of world leaders to Kenya is expected to boost the tourism sector, which is recovering from travel advisories.
Britain has withdrawn travel advisories against Kenya and America is expected to follow suit.
“Starting of direct flights between Kenya and the U.S. as Obama promised would really promote trade and tourism,” said Ms Fitzgerald.

Naira drops to 224 as dollar demand rises

The naira dropped against the dollar at the parallel market on Tuesday driven by demand mainly from individuals travelling abroad for summer holidays and importers, traders said.
The local currency was quoted at 224 to the greenback at the black market, 0.89 per cent weaker than 222 it was sold on Monday, Reuters reported.
At the official interbank market, the naira closed at 197, a level it has been stuck at following the Central Bank of Nigeria’s peg on the exchange rate in February.
“We’ve seen a surge in dollar demand … since Friday,” a Nigerian Bureaux de Change operator, Harrison Owoh, said, adding that the CBN might sell dollars this week.
Owoh said the bank sold around $160m to BDCs last week to increase dollar supply.
BDCs are allowed to sell up to $4,000 as personal travelling allowance and $5,000 as business travelling allowance.
However, individuals sometimes buy above the stipulated dollar limit from the undocumented parallel market.
The naira had appreciated to 216 at the parallel market last week after banks stopped accepting hard currency cash deposits on CBN orders, fuelling excess dollar liquidity at the parallel market.
The central bank has also directed lenders to pay for dollars purchased at the official market 48 hours in advance, tightening naira liquidity.
